Technical Problem

Existing load carriers are easily damaged during transportation, resulting in damage to goods and unstable transportation. In particular, when a used load carrier is used, it is difficult to ensure its integrity and safety.

Method used

A load carrier control device including a sensor device and a computing device is used, and AI applications and computer vision technology are used to automatically inspect the quality characteristics of the load carrier, especially the integrity of its top and side surfaces, detect defects such as protruding parts, breakage and foreign objects, and initiate corresponding actions through automated applications.

Benefits of technology

The integrity of the load carrier is automatically checked before use to ensure that it is not damaged during the loading process, thereby avoiding the high cost of using a new load carrier and allowing the used load carrier to continue to be used, reducing transportation costs and improving safety and stability.

Abstract

A load carrier control apparatus (1) comprises a control device (50) comprising a sensor device (51) and a computing device (52). The computing device (52) is adapted and designed to check a quality characteristic of the controllable load carrier (100) based on the data captured by the sensor device (51) using an evaluation based on an automation application, including an AI application and / or at least one computer vision application. A method for operating such a load carrier control device (1) comprises inferring at least one quality feature using an automation application and initiating a corresponding predetermined operation. The use relates to an automation application comprising at least one AI application and / or at least one computer vision application for controlling the load carrier (100).

Description

Technical Field

[0001] The invention relates to a load carrier control device comprising at least one control device, wherein the control device comprises at least one sensor device and at least one computing device. The invention also relates to a method for operating the load carrier control device and the use thereof. Background Art

[0002] Load carriers are used to receive objects to be transported, or even multiple objects, to ensure standardized transportation of these objects. Load carriers can be made from a variety of materials and have different shapes and configurations.

[0003] For example, there are wooden flat pallets, so-called Euro pallets (EN 13698-1), which have a specified base area of ​​800 mm x 1200 mm.

[0004] This standardized load carrier offers numerous advantages when it comes to transporting individual objects and / or, for example, stacked individual pieces of goods. This means that generally all industrial trucks can pick up and transport such pallets.

[0005] Furthermore, the standardized bottom area allows for appropriate preselection of predetermined layer patterns and / or bag sizes in relation to subsequent layer patterns when stacking bags on such a pallet.

[0006] The construction of a load carrier is generally relatively simple. The aforementioned Euro pallet consists of wooden slats and blocks connected in a predetermined pattern by means of nails.

[0007] However, the problem with these pallets is that they are also susceptible to damage during transport, with individual slats potentially splintering or even breaking completely, and nails potentially protruding into the loading area.

[0008] Protruding parts, such as wooden slats and / or protruding nails, other foreign objects, and / or deformed wood or slats can damage the goods being transported. In particular, when bags filled with bulk goods are stacked on defective pallets, the bags directly on the pallet can be damaged, and the bulk goods can spill. Depending on the type of bulk material, the resulting dust can contaminate the surrounding area and / or even create a hazardous situation if the bulk material is harmful to health and / or the environment.

[0009] If individual slats and / or blocks of a pallet are missing and / or deformed, the pallet will usually be too unstable to ensure safe transportation.

[0010] Since palletizing operations are largely automated in many regions, only new, and therefore hopefully undamaged, pallets are used in some areas to avoid adverse effects from defects in the shipped goods. For example, in the case of overseas shipments, if the cargo contains bags filled with bulk materials and dust contamination or contaminants are detected when the container is opened, the entire container will not be accepted and will be returned. This can result in high costs, so only new pallets are used as a precautionary measure.

[0011] However, using new pallets in turn results in high costs, and the new pallets may also be defective or damaged shortly before being automatically loaded.

[0012] For example, with collapsible boxes, folding boxes, grid boxes, racks, and / or other such load carrying racks, issues of integrity and / or proper alignment and / or installation are critical. Summary of the Invention

[0013] It is therefore an object of the present invention to avoid damage to the load due to defects and / or improper design of the load carrier, in particular when using used load carriers such as shared pallets, circulation pallets and / or reusable pallets.

[0015] The load carrier control device according to the invention comprises at least one control device, wherein the control device comprises at least one sensor device and at least one computing device. The computing device is adapted and designed to check at least one quality feature of at least the upper side of at least one unloaded load carrier to be controlled based on data captured by the sensor device using an evaluation based on at least one automated application, wherein the automated application comprises at least one AI application and / or at least one computer vision application.

[0016] Empty load carriers are controlled in particular meaning that packed load carriers, thus load units comprising a load carrier and packages arranged thereon, are not taken into account, but only empty or unpacked or unloaded or unfilled load carriers, such as pallets, are taken into account.

[0017] In this context, load carriers specifically refer to standardized load carriers, such as so-called Euro pallets. Depending on their configuration, such load carriers can be made of different materials and have certain other characteristics, such as shape, height, and / or container for industrial trucks. For example, Euro pallets are typically made of wood and are constructed so that conventional industrial trucks (such as forklifts and / or pallet jacks) can drive under or inside the pallet and then lift it for further transport. However, other load carriers can also be made of or include other materials and their shapes and other characteristics may also vary.

[0018] However, load carriers are also to be understood as including pallets made of other materials and load carriers having different shapes or designs, such as collapsible boxes, folding boxes, lattice boxes, racks and / or the like.

[0019] The computing means preferably comprises and / or is provided by at least one computer and / or similar device.

[0020] Quality characteristics refer in particular to the integrity of the load carrier or at least the upper side of the load carrier on which the goods or load to be transported are placed. For example, depending on the design, a quality characteristic is preferably to check whether all parts of the load carrier are present, intact or undamaged, and / or whether any foreign objects protrude from the loading surface or the upper surface of the load carrier. For example, in the field of Euro pallets, it can be checked whether all slats or blocks are present, whether any individual slats are broken or splintered, or whether any slat parts are tilted and could pierce the goods to be loaded, and / or whether any nails or other foreign objects or parts of previous loads protrude from the upper side of the load carrier, potentially damaging the load. Depending on the configuration, it is often necessary to check in particular whether planks, boards, and / or surfaces are deformed and / or missing, and whether this could render the load carrier and / or the load unstable or potentially damage the load.

[0021] At least the upper side of the load carrier is checked or controlled and subsequent loads are placed on the upper side. Preferably, however, the side and / or bottom side of the load carrier is also controlled for damage by means of the load carrier control device.

[0022] The load carrier control device according to the invention can be used in particular in the field of loading bags filled with bulk material.

[0023] In particular, an automation application is at least a processor-based application or a computer-based application, which processes or further processes or analyzes data captured by the sensor device.

[0024] According to the invention, the automation application is at least one AI application and / or at least one computer vision application and / or comprises at least one of these applications.

[0025] Computer vision refers in particular to the analysis of images and videos using computer programs. The goal of this analysis is, in particular, to extract information contained in the images. Depending on the configuration, probabilistic methods, image processing methods, projective geometry, deep learning, and computer graphics are preferably used.

[0026] In the field of AI applications any application in the field of artificial intelligence can be used which can be advantageously used for monitoring with regard to the control of the load carrier.

[0027] In particular, the use of machine learning (ML), a subfield of artificial intelligence (AI), is advantageous here. The core components of machine learning are algorithms and methods that enable programs to learn from data without being explicitly programmed. This means that these programs can preferably make decisions independently. In particular, a distinction is made between supervised, unsupervised, and semi-supervised learning. Supervised learning methods include, but are not limited to, convolutional neural networks (also known as spatially invariant artificial neural networks) and their further developments, such as region-based convolutional neural networks. These improvements over traditional neural networks are particularly suitable for image processing applications because, depending on the configuration, one or more preprocessing steps, such as a convolution operation, are performed before the neural network.

[0028] Specifically, sensors (e.g., optical sensors, cameras such as color or black and white, thermal imaging, etc.) are used to record data about a specific state. These images are then associated with their states by assigning a corresponding label (marker) to each state (image = information matrix).

[0029] Defects in the load carrier detected by the control device can also be used as a further data basis for training.

[0030] This declared information is then preferably transferred / learned into a CNN (Convolutional Neural Network) using a machine learning or AI method or AI application.

[0031] For example, as sensors observe a load carrier, data is continuously passed through a CNN, which directly evaluates the state, which is then further processed by the controller (e.g., defective load carrier detected = discard load carrier).

[0032] For example, the sensor device may be and / or include a camera device, or, depending on the configuration, may also include or be configured as an acoustic sensor, a temperature sensor and / or at least another suitable sensor.

[0033] The load carrier control device according to the invention offers numerous advantages. One significant advantage is that an empty load carrier can be automatically checked before use or before loading, packaging or filling, thereby ensuring that the load carrier itself is in good condition or not damaged or intact during subsequent loading.

[0034] Whether a load carrier packed with a load has predetermined properties or quality characteristics and / or is not damaged can preferably be controlled using a device provided for this purpose or, depending on the configuration, preferably also in a separate step using the device according to the invention.

[0035] By reliably checking the integrity of load carriers with the aid of AI applications or computer vision applications, it is possible to further use already used load carriers, in particular for sensitive loads or transporting sensitive areas, thus eliminating the need for new and therefore very expensive load carriers.

[0036] The additional costs of such a load carrier control device can therefore usually be offset very quickly, since, on the one hand, it is cheaper to use a used load carrier and, on the other hand, damage to a new load carrier can be avoided, particularly in the area of ​​automatic loading or palletizing.

[0037] The control device is preferably operatively connected to at least one controller, to which the evaluation of the automated application can be transmitted. In particular, such a controller can be part of the load carrier control device or incorporated therein. However, depending on the configuration, the controller can also be a separate component or assigned to another system, for example, for transporting load carriers. Since the controller can preferably initiate predetermined actions based on the evaluation of the automated application, for example, defective or damaged load carriers can be removed from an automated load carrier transport system.

[0038] Particularly preferably, the sensor device comprises at least one camera device. With this camera device, images or image data can be recorded, in particular of the upper side of the load carrier to be controlled, so that reliable conclusions can be drawn about damage to the load carrier by evaluating the images with the aid of an automated application. In particular, depending on the configuration, the camera detection area captures not only the upper side of the load carrier but also at least the side surfaces of the load carrier.

[0039] Preferably, such camera means may comprise any suitable type of camera. In particular, conventional webcams may also be used here.

[0040] In a suitable configuration, at least one conveyor device is included for the load carrier to be controlled. For example, such a conveyor device or transport system for the load carrier can be included in the load carrier control device and / or assigned to the load carrier control device. In this way, pallets can be transported to a loading or palletizing location using the conveyor device and, in particular, automatically controlled during transport to prevent damage.

[0041] In an advantageous refinement, the conveying device is adapted and designed to at least partially and / or at least temporarily release the underside of the conveyed load carrier for control. This allows, in particular, the load carrier to be inspected from below for damage. Depending on the configuration and design of the load carrier control device, the entire load carrier can be controlled.

[0042] Preferably, the control device is adapted and designed to detect protruding nails, broken and / or splintered laths, foreign objects, deformed and / or damaged surfaces, and / or missing parts as quality features. In particular, it is possible to detect, check, or assess whether the load carrier complies with predetermined requirements or quality regulations. It is therefore also possible to check whether the correct type of pallet is being used.

[0043] The method according to the invention is suitable for operating a load carrier control device as described above. In this case, the control device uses an automation application to infer at least one quality characteristic based on the evaluation of data from the sensor device and to initiate a corresponding predetermined action, wherein the automation application includes at least one AI application and / or at least one computer vision application.

[0044] In particular, the predetermined action may be at least one error message, a warning and / or the ejection or non-use or removal of the load carrier detected as defective.

[0045] The definitions of artificial intelligence and computer vision described previously for the load carrier control device according to the invention also apply here.

[0046] The method according to the invention also offers the advantages described previously with respect to the load carrier control device.

[0047] Preferably, the automated application examines the data online. For example, the data may be used to distribute computing processes across multiple computing stations or computing applications available online to identify predetermined events.

[0048] The automation application is particularly preferably trained and / or can be used offline on a computing device. Depending on the configuration, the automation application can first be trained online to provide the most extensive and powerful computing power possible for training. Depending on the configuration, any further functions and further learning can also be performed locally.

[0049] When improvements are appropriate, the automated application can be retrained. This can be done online, offline, or using other methods and procedures.

[0050] Particularly preferably, protruding nails, broken and / or chipped slats, foreign objects, and / or missing parts are checked as quality features. In particular, the load carrier is checked to see whether it meets predetermined requirements or quality features. It is also preferably possible to check, for example, whether the correct type of pallet is being used. For foldable boxes, lattice boxes, and / or folding boxes, for example, it is possible to check whether these boxes are correctly unfolded, positioned, and / or aligned, and / or whether there are missing or defective parts, and / or whether damage and / or foreign objects in the area of ​​the loading surface could cause damage to the load.

[0060] Figure 1 A load carrier control device 1 according to the invention is shown purely schematically in a (partial) perspective view with a load carrier 100 to be checked.

[0061] In the exemplary embodiment shown, the integrity of a load carrier 100, in particular its upper side 101, is checked with the aid of a load carrier control device according to the invention. In the exemplary embodiment shown, the load carrier is a so-called Euro pallet 103, which is a special or standardized wooden flat pallet.

[0062] In the exemplary embodiment shown here, the load carrier control device 1 comprises a control device 50, which in this case comprises a sensor device 51 and a computing device 52. In the exemplary embodiment shown here, the computing device 52 is a computer 53, which is online or connected to the Internet, as indicated by the corresponding reference numerals.

[0063] In the exemplary embodiment shown here, the sensor device 51 comprises a camera device 54, which is designed here as a conventional webcam 55. With the aid of this sensor device 51 or camera device 54, an empty load carrier 100 to be controlled or a corresponding detection area 56 can be recorded and / or set.

[0064] Depending on the configuration, the detection area 56 corresponds to the entire recording area of ​​the camera device 54. However, it is generally also possible to reduce a larger image area to a specific detection area 56 as part of image processing by the computing device 52 and / or the user.

[0065] The computing device 52 or the computer 53 checks the images or image data captured by the sensor device 51 or the camera device 54 or the webcam 55 for defects by means of automated applications including at least one AI application and / or computer vision application. In particular, compliance with certain quality characteristics is checked or, conversely, compliance with all predefined quality requirements of at least the upper side 101 of the empty load carrier 100 or the pallet 103 is checked by detecting any defects.

[0066] Furthermore, a controller 30 is provided, which in the exemplary embodiment shown here is included in the load carrier control device 1. This controller 30 is operatively connected to the control device 50 or to the computing device 52, so that the evaluations generated by the computing device 52 can be transmitted to the controller 30.

[0067] In the exemplary embodiment shown, the controller 30 can perform predetermined actions based on the evaluation of the computing device 52. For example, a warning signal can be output, or in the case of an automated transport system for load carriers, the transport system can be stopped, or, for example, a detected defective pallet or a defective load carrier 100 can be ejected from the transport system or conveyor so that it is no longer used.

[0068] Figure 2 Again, it is shown that Figure 1 An exemplary embodiment of the invention, wherein load carriers 100 or Euro pallets 103 which do not meet quality requirements are controlled here.

[0069] The exemplary embodiment shown here shows that the detection area 56 can also be used to detect that not all components are present in the pallet 103 or the load carrier 100, which would impair stability. In the exemplary embodiment shown, two corner pieces 104 are missing and therefore the slats 105 connected thereto lack sufficient stability.

[0070] Figure 3 Shown again Figure 1 An exemplary embodiment of a load carrier control device 1 according to the invention is shown, wherein a further defect of a pallet 103 or a load carrier 100 is shown in purely schematic form.

[0071] In the exemplary embodiment shown here, the slat 105 is broken or partially broken, so that larger fragments 106 protrude upwards, which could damage the load to be picked up. The broken area is also shown in an enlarged view.

[0072] Especially when loading bags filled with bulk materials, the bags may become damaged, causing the bulk material to spill, which may cause contamination or even be dangerous.

[0073] Figure 4 Again, the Figure 1 1 , wherein another detectable defect of a load carrier 100 or a pallet 103 is shown by way of example.

[0074] In the exemplary embodiment shown here, in particular as shown in the enlarged view, a protruding nail 107 is detected. Such a nail 107 or other foreign objects protruding from the upper side 101 of the load carrier 100 can also cause damage, in particular to bags filled with bulk material, and thus can lead to the above-mentioned defects.

[0075] Figure 5 A purely schematic diagram shows another exemplary embodiment of a load carrier control device 1 according to the invention, the basic structure of which corresponds to the exemplary embodiment described above.

[0076] In the exemplary embodiment shown, it is also shown that the load carrier control apparatus 1 can comprise a conveying device 60 or be assigned to such a conveying device 60 .

[0077] A load carrier 100 (in the exemplary embodiment shown, a pallet or Euro-pallet 103) is transported, for example, from a warehouse to a loading location by means of such a conveyor device 60. Here, too, the upper side 101 and the side surfaces of the load carrier 100 are inspected by means of a first sensor device 51 or a camera device 54 (in this example, a webcam 55).

[0078] In contrast to the exemplary embodiments shown previously, the control device 50 here comprises a second sensor device 51 or a camera device 54 or a webcam 55. The second camera device 54 is arranged such that its detection area 56 can record at least a portion of the underside 102 of the load carrier 100 or the Euro pallet 103.

[0079] In the exemplary embodiment shown here, the conveyor device 60 has a groove 61 so that when corresponding parts of the pallet 103 are conveyed through the groove 61 of the conveyor device 60, the camera device 54 can inspect or control the bottom side 102 of the load carrier 100 in sections while it is conveyed by the conveyor device 60.

[0080] Optionally, such a load carrier control device 1 can also include a rotation device or be assigned to a rotation device in order to check all freely accessible surfaces, in particular the surface 101 and the sides, from one camera position (thus using only one camera). The bottom side 102 can then be controlled, for example, by completely turning the load carrier 100 over and / or lifting or tilting the load carrier 100 at least temporarily (for example, by 90° about a longitudinal side).
